Raiders looking for three-peat in Georgia Class AAAAAA against 10-time champion Walton.

Alpharetta could be the first nationally-ranked team to capture a state championship Thursday when it meets Walton (Marietta) in Georgia's Class AAAAAA final. No. 15 in this week's MaxPreps Top 25 high school volleyball rankings, the Raiders are looking for a three-peat and fourth title in six seasons. 

After losing key pieces of last year's championship team to graduation, Alpharetta has continued its success with a mix of veterans, a freshman setter and a 6-foot-2 sophomore transfer from Florida.

Kennedi White and Stephanie Payne provide the senior leadership for the Raiders while freshman Susie Dai has 523 assists in 99 sets. Class of 2028 standout Leilani Lamar leads the team with 297 kills after joining the program from Tampa Prep (Tampa, Fla.).

Alpharetta  previously won state titles in 2020, 2023 and 2024. Walton, the MaxPreps National Champion in 2017, is looking for its first state crown since 2021 after winning 10 in 12 years between 2010 and 2021.

In California, No. 4 Marymount (Los Angeles) hosts No. 21 Mira Costa (Manhattan Beach) in the Southern Section quarterfinals. The winner advances to the semifinals and a potential showdown with No. 2 Sierra Canyon (Chatsworth)



The other side of the bracket features No. 3 Mater Dei (Santa Ana) taking on Harvard-Westlake (Studio City) and No. 11 Redondo Union (Redondo Beach) battling San Juan Hills (San Juan Capistrano)

The section final is set for Nov. 8 at Cerritos College.

In Indiana, the Class 4A quarterfinals also feature a pair of MaxPreps Top 25 teams as unbeaten No. 7 Carroll (Fort Wayne) takes on No. 13 Westfield. The winner Saturday morning match has to turn around and play an evening semi-state match against either Penn (Mishawaka) or Crown Point for a trip to the state title game Nov. 8.

No. 1 Byron Nelson (Trophy Club, Texas) wrapped up an unbeaten regular season with just three dropped sets in 36 matches. The Bobcats open the Conference 6A Division 1 playoffs against Lake Ridge (Mansfield).

A run to a second straight title would also secure back-to-back national crowns, something done only once before by Papillion-LaVista South (Papillion, Neb.) in 2010 and 2011.
